The epgshare01 project on GitHub provides a massive, community-driven database of EPGs. It solves a primary pain point in streaming by converting raw television schedule data into standardized .xml files (often compressed as .xml.gz ), allowing media players to display channel logos, show times, descriptions, and metadata flawlessly.
